CHAMPAIGN -- Spend five bucks at a downtown business, get free parking. Sounds like a good deal,  right?

If you spend $5.00 or more at any business or restaurant downtown, you get four hours free parking in the Hill Street parking deck.

It's to support downtown businesses. The deal lasts through December.
